How much does an Electro/Mechanical Technician II make in Alabama? The average Electro/Mechanical Technician II salary in Alabama is $57,326 as of March 26, 2024, but the range typically falls between $49,037 and $65,270.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on the city and many other important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ession.

Electro/Mechanical Technician II provides on-site support and technical assistance with various electro-mechanical products, equipment, and systems. Troubleshoots malfunctions by reworking, repairing, or modifying non-conforming parts and assemblies within equipment. Being an Electro/Mechanical Technician II installs new equipment or upgrades and provides routine maintenance to ensure function and uptime. Performs trial runs of machinery to test quality and performance rates and trains users on operation and maintenance. Additionally, Electro/Mechanical Technician II develops detailed service reports to document service visits, issues, and troubleshooting actions and logs and tracks maintenance activities. May require an associate degree. Typically reports to a supervisor. The Electro/Mechanical Technician II works under moderate supervision. Gaining or has attained full proficiency in a specific area of discipline. To be an Electro/Mechanical Technician II typically requires 1-3 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)... A career path is a sequence of jobs that leads to your short- and long-term career goals. Some follow a linear career path within one field, while others change fields periodically to achieve career or personal goals.
For Electro/Mechanical Technician II, the first career path typically starts with a Field Service Technician III position, and then Field Service Supervisor.
The second career path typically starts with an Electro/Mechanical Technician III position, and then progresses to Electro/Mechanical Technician IV.
The third career path typically progresses to Power Systems Rental Operations Manager.
Additionally, the fourth career path typically starts with a Field Operator III position, and then progresses to Field Operations Supervisor.
